We prove that the motivic cohomology of mixed characteristic schemes, introduced in our previous work, satisfies various expected properties of motivic cohomology, including a motivic refinement of Weibel's vanishing in algebraic $K$-theory, the projective bundle formula, a comparison to Milnor $K$-theory, and a universal characterisation in terms of pro cdh descent. These results extend those of Elmanto--Morrow to schemes which are not necessarily defined over a field.

Finite-coefficient Gersten injectivity fails in ramified mixed characteristic
The paper constructs a nonzero mod-3 K_2 class on a ramified regular local ring that dies in the fraction field, disproving finite-coefficient Gersten injectivity in this setting.
